Breaking Bad star Bryan Cranston’s warning after COVID-19 – The New Daily
Breaking Bad star Bryan Cranston says he’s recovered from COVID-19 and donated his plasma so his antibodies might help others with the disease.

Breaking Bad star Bryan Cranston has urged people to wear masks in a video, as he also revealed he had recovered from the coronavirus.
The Emmy Award-winning actor has donated his plasma in the hopes his antibodies will help others with the disease.
Cranston revealed the news in an Instagram video documenting the donation process at a blood and plasma centre run by the University of California at Los Angeles.
